在现代网络中,越来越多的人需要使用翻墙工具以保障上网隐私和安全。其中,Shadowsocks作为一种高效的代理工具,受到广泛使用。本文将详细介绍如何在华硕AC68U路由器上安装和配置opkg和luci-app-shadowsocks,帮助用户顺利实现科学上网。
什么是AC68U路由器
AC68U是一款由华硕公司生产的高性能无线路由器,支持802.11ac无线标准。其拥有双频并发、强大的硬件配置以及出色的信号覆盖能力,使其成为许多家庭和小型办公环境的理想选择。此外,AC68U支持OpenWrt系统,这使得它可以通过额外的软件包进行扩展和自定义。
什么是opkg
opkg是OpenWrt的包管理工具,类似于Linux系统中的apt或yum。用户可以通过opkg方便地安装、卸载和管理软件包,使路由器的功能得到增强。对于AC68U路由器而言,安装opkg是实现更多自定义功能的第一步。
什么是luci-app-shadowsocks
luci-app-shadowsocks是一个为Shadowsocks提供图形用户界面(GUI)的OpenWrt软件包。它允许用户更直观地配置Shadowsocks服务,轻松实现代理设置,适合普通用户使用。结合opkg使用,能够有效提高路由器的科学上网能力。
安装前的准备工作
在开始之前,请确保:
- 你的AC68U路由器已经刷入了OpenWrt系统。
- 路由器已连接至互联网。
- 具备基本的SSH使用知识,以便于访问路由器。
安装opkg
-
登录路由器
使用SSH客户端(如PuTTY)登录到路由器的IP地址(通常是192.168.1.1)。 bash ssh root@192.168.1.1 -
更新包管理器
登录成功后,输入以下命令更新opkg:
bash opkg update -
安装opkg相关工具
如果尚未安装opkg,使用以下命令进行安装:
bash opkg install opkg
安装luci-app-shadowsocks
1. 更新软件源
在终端中运行以下命令,确保软件源是最新的: bash opkg update
2. 安装luci-app-shadowsocks
使用下面的命令来安装luci-app-shadowsocks: bash opkg install luci-app-shadowsocks
3. 安装Shadowsocks核心
此外,还需安装Shadowsocks核心组件,运行以下命令: bash opkg install shadowsocks-libev
4. 配置luci-app-shadowsocks
完成安装后,登录到路由器的Web界面(通常是http://192.168.1.1),导航到“服务” > “Shadowsocks”。在此处,你可以配置Shadowsocks的参数,例如服务器地址、端口、加密方式等。
如何使用luci-app-shadowsocks
-
添加一个新服务器
点击“添加”按钮,填写服务器信息,包括:- 服务器地址
- 端口
- 密码
- 加密方式
-
启用服务
完成服务器配置后,确保启用Shadowsocks服务。 -
设置防火墙规则
在“网络” > “防火墙”中添加新的防火墙规则,以允许Shadowsocks流量通过。
常见问题解答(FAQ)
Q1: AC68U路由器可以使用哪个版本的OpenWrt?
A1: AC68U路由器支持多个版本的OpenWrt,但推荐使用最新的稳定版本,以确保安全性和功能性。
Q2: 如何判断luci-app-shadowsocks是否安装成功?
A2: 你可以在路由器的Web界面中找到“服务” > “Shadowsocks”选项,如果该选项存在,说明安装成功。
Q3: 如果luci-app-shadowsocks无法连接怎么办?
A3: – 检查输入的服务器地址、端口和密码是否正确;
- 确认你的网络是否通畅;
- 检查Shadowsocks服务器是否在线。
Q4: AC68U支持哪些类型的加密方式?
A4: AC68U支持多种加密方式,包括aes-256-gcm、aes-128-gcm等,具体选择可根据需要而定。
总结
通过以上步骤,我们成功地在AC68U路由器上安装和配置了opkg以及luci-app-shadowsocks。这不仅增强了路由器的功能,同时也为用户提供了更安全的上网体验。希望本指南对您有所帮助,如果您在安装过程中遇到问题,请参考FAQ部分或查阅相关资料。